In the world of cinema, fashion plays a vital role in bringing characters to life and telling their stories. One such iconic film that showcases the power of style is “To Die For (1995)” directed by Gus Van Sant. This dark comedy-drama explores the life of Suzanne Stone (played by Nicole Kidman), a ruthless and ambitious weather reporter who will stop at nothing to achieve her dreams of fame and fortune. Nicole Kidman as Suzanne Stone: The Ambitious Femme Fatale
Nicole Kidman’s portrayal of Suzanne Stone in “To Die For (1995)” is a masterclass in character styling. Suzanne’s fashion sense is the epitome of sophistication and ambition. She exudes power and confidence through her clothing choices, which often feature tailored suits, figure-hugging dresses, and high-end accessories.
Outfit Details
- Suits: Suzanne Stone’s go-to outfit is a well-tailored suit that accentuates her figure. Opt for sharp blazers with padded shoulders and high-waisted trousers to replicate her powerful look. Add a touch of femininity with a silk blouse in a bold color.
- Dresses: Suzanne’s dresses are form-fitting and elegant. Look for bodycon silhouettes in luxurious fabrics like satin or silk. Choose deep V-necks or halter necklines to emulate her allure. Accessorize with statement jewelry to complete the ensemble.
- Accessories: Suzanne’s accessories are always on point. Don’t forget to add oversized sunglasses, a sleek clutch, and high heels to your outfit. These accessories will elevate your look and give you that undeniable Suzanne Stone vibe.
Matt Dillon as Larry Maretto: The Casual Cool
Matt Dillon’s character, Larry Maretto, provides a stark contrast to Suzanne Stone’s polished style. Larry’s fashion choices embody the laid-back and effortless cool of the 90s grunge scene. His wardrobe consists of relaxed-fit jeans, vintage band t-shirts, and flannel shirts.
Outfit Details
- Jeans: Opt for loose-fitting, slightly distressed jeans to replicate Larry’s casual look. Pair them with a simple white t-shirt or a vintage band tee for an authentic 90s vibe.
- Flannel Shirts: Larry is often seen sporting flannel shirts tied around his waist or worn as a layering piece. Look for plaid patterns in earthy tones like red, green, or brown.
- Footwear: Complete the look with a pair of worn-in sneakers or classic Doc Martens. These shoes will add an edgy touch to your Larry Maretto-inspired outfit.
